Do Ladybugs Turn Into Beetles?

During complete metamorphosis, ladybugs progress through four distinct life stages: egg, larva, pupa, and adult. Initially, female ladybugs lay bright yellow eggs in clusters near food sources, such as plants. Upon hatching, the larvae, which resemble slender caterpillars, immediately begin to feed. The larval stage is followed by the pupal stage, where larvae pupate for one to two weeks. During this transformative period, they metamorphose from spiky, soft-bodied insects into the familiar vibrantly colored flying beetles with hard forewings and chewing mouthparts.

Ladybugs are scientifically recognized as beetles of the family Coccinellidae and undergo a complete metamorphosis, a feature that distinguishes them from other insects. The life cycle consists of embryonic (egg), larval (larvae), pupal (pupae), and imaginal (adult beetles) stages. While the term "bug" is commonly used, it specifically refers to true bugs of the order Hemiptera, whereas ladybugs belong to the order Coleoptera.

Interestingly, some ladybug larvae can grow larger than the adult beetles. They are covered by a chitinous structure often decorated with appendages that vary in shape and size based on the species. How Do Ladybugs Molt?

Ladybugs undergo a fascinating life cycle with four distinct stages: egg, larva, pupa, and adult. Female ladybugs lay bright yellow eggs in clusters of 10 to 50 on the undersides of leaves, typically near a food source to protect them from predators. Once the eggs hatch, they enter the larval stage, which lasts about a month. During this phase, the larvae resemble tiny alligators, possessing elongated bodies and bumpy exoskeletons. Their primary activity is eating, as they voraciously consume aphids and other small pests.

Ladybug larvae undergo a molting process, shedding their exoskeletons, known as the cuticle, several times as they grow. This process consists of four instars, with each molt resulting in a larger and more developed larva. After the larval stage, the larvae prepare to pupate by attaching themselves to leaves and transforming into pupae. This pupal stage, known as prepupa, marks a significant shift in their development.

How Do Ladybug Larvae Move?

The life cycle of a ladybug includes four stages: egg, larva, pupa, and adult. Initially, female ladybugs lay clusters of yellow eggs on plants near food sources. Once the eggs hatch, the larvae emerge and go through several growth stages, known as instars, which involve molting four times. Unlike many insects, ladybug larvae resemble small alligators, exhibiting elongated bodies, six legs, and bumpy exoskeletons, often black in color. During this active larval stage, they hunt and feed on pests until they are ready to pupate.

As the larvae transition to the pupal stage, they attach themselves belly-first to a surface like a plant leaf, where they cease movement and feeding. This prepupal state is crucial as the larvae begin to change drastically within the pupa. The pupal stage is characterized by the breakdown of the larval body, allowing for the development of adult features under the guidance of specialized cells called histoblasts. After a period of this transformation, the adult ladybug emerges, complete with six legs, a pair of antennae, and two pairs of spotted wings.

Typically, the entire life cycle of a ladybug lasts about two months, with the egg stage lasting around seven days, the larval stage up to a month, and the pupal stage about a week.
